Perception of colours andmotion is explained in the light of the new findings of parallel parvocellular (P) and magnocellular (M) pathways. Discrimination of colours isrendered possible by the following important structures of the P pathway: P ganglion cells in the retina - parvocellular layers in the thalamic lateral geniculate nucleus (LGN) - "blob" regions in the primary visual cortex V1 - V4visual area. Important structures of the M pathway providing for the discrimination of motion include: M ganglion cells in the retina-magnocelllular layers in the LGN-primary visual cortex V1 - V5 visual area. Location of other cortical areas involved in vision is presented; the visual pathway responsible for what is seen ends in the temporal cortex, and the pathway concerned with motion (where the objects are) ends in the parietalcortex. Clinical data for cerebral achromatopsia (complete colour blindness), akinetopsia (inability to discern movement of objects), prosopagnosia (inability to recognise familiar faces), also speak for the existence of several functionally specialised visual cortical areas. For the conscious perception of light and movement simultaneous activity of several visual areas seems to be necessary</dc:description><dc:description xml:lang="sl">Članek opisuje osnovna in nova spoznanja o vidni poti pri človeku, ki so jih omogočile tehnike slikanja možganov, neinvazivne elektrofiziološke in druge metode. Prikazana je novejša razlaga zaznavanja barv in gibanja, ki temelji naodkritju dveh vzporednih poti obdelave optičnega dražljaja, drobno- (P) in velikocelične (M) poti. Pomembne strukture poti F ki omogoča analizo barv, so:ganglijske celice P v mrežnici - drobnocelične plasti v talamičnem lateralnem genikulatnem jedru - kapljičaste strukture (blob) v primarni vidni skorji V1-vidno področje V4. Pomembne strukture poti M, ki omogoča analizo gibanja, so ganglijske celice M v mrežnici - velikocelične plasti v lateralnemgenikulatnem jedru - primarna vidna skorja V1-vidno področje V5. Opisanaje lokacija drugih področij možganske skorje, pomembnih za vid; v senčnem režnju se konča pot, ki je pomembna za prepoznavanje oblik ("pot kaj"), medtem ko se v temenskem režnju konča pot, ki je pomembna za prostorskozaznavo ("pot kje"). Tudi podatki, pridobljeni v kliničnih stanjih, kot so možganska akromatopsija (nezmožnost zaznavanja barv), akinetopsija (nezmožnost zaznavanja gibanja), prozopagnozija (neprepoznavanje znanih obrazov), kažejo na obstoj več funkcijsko specializiranih središč. Za zavestnozaznavo zunanjega sveta se zdi, da je potrebna sočasna aktivnost številnih vidnih področij</dc:description><edm:type>TEXT</edm:type><dc:type xml:lang="sl">znanstveno časopisje</dc:type><dc:type xml:lang="en">journals</dc:type><dc:type rdf:resource="http://www.wikidata.org/entity/Q361785" /></edm:ProvidedCHO><ore:Aggregation rdf:about="http://www.dlib.si/?URN=URN:NBN:SI:DOC-MWKT8DNY"><edm:aggregatedCHO rdf:resource="URN:NBN:SI:DOC-MWKT8DNY" /><edm:isShownBy rdf:resource="http://www.dlib.si/stream/URN:NBN:SI:DOC-MWKT8DNY/cc287d7d-9e23-4c75-8d61-d4f44a6302b7/PDF" /><edm:rights rdf:resource="http://rightsstatements.org/vocab/InC/1.0/" /><edm:provider>Slovenian National E-content Aggregator</edm:provider><edm:intermediateProvider xml:lang="en">National and University Library of Slovenia</edm:intermediateProvider><edm:dataProvider xml:lang="sl">Društvo Medicinski razgledi</edm:dataProvider><edm:object rdf:resource="http://www.dlib.si/streamdb/URN:NBN:SI:DOC-MWKT8DNY/maxi/edm" /><edm:isShownAt rdf:resource="http://www.dlib.si/details/URN:NBN:SI:DOC-MWKT8DNY" /></ore:Aggregation></rdf:RDF>
